Abstract
The invention relates to compositions containing dye, containing (A) at least one dye, (B) at least one organopolysiloxane containing units of the general formula R(RO)SiO(I), wherein the radicals and indexes have the meaning indicated in claim, provided that the total is a+b≤3 and in more than 80% of all units, the formula (I) is equal to 2, and (C) at least one siloxane-organo-copolymer. The invention further relates to a method for the production thereof and to the use thereof in the dyeing of polymer materials.
